How they compare

Slovenia currently reports 16.86 % against 15.96 % in Uruguay, a difference of 0.9 %.

That makes Slovenia's figure about 1.1 times Uruguay's.

The two have swapped places 2 times across 32 shared years of data; in 1992 it was Slovenia ahead.

Slovenia ranks 130th and Uruguay ranks 132nd of 208 countries.

Slovenia has averaged higher in every one of the 4 decades both report.

Head to head by decade

Decade Slovenia Uruguay Difference Ahead
1990s 22.97 % 1.53 % 21.43 % Slovenia
2000s 25.85 % 2.61 % 23.24 % Slovenia
2010s 18.08 % 12.06 % 6.02 % Slovenia
2020s 16.95 % 16.35 % 0.5975 % Slovenia

Averages of every year both report within each decade.
